PTLLS award is a nationally recognised qualification for anyone wishing to teach or train in the lifelong learning sector (non compulsory education). PTLLS is currently the industry benchmark and minimum requirement for people who want to work as trainers. It is a stepping stone to achieving the Certificate or Diploma in Teaching in the Lifelong Learning Sector (CTLLS and DTLLS). The actual qualification is accredited by NCFE and is called Level 3/4 award in Preparing to Teach in the Lifelong Learning Sector.

Firstly you complete an online learning course (Moodle), consisting of 8 modules of virtual lessons, reading and completing questions and activities. Each module is different in length but takes between 2-3 hours.
After the completion of each module, you are required to complete and submit an assignment of approx 200 words. You will also complete a scheme of work, lesson plan and micro teach.
The subjects covered on the Moodle are:
The Role of the Teacher
Responsibilities and Boundaries
Teaching
Learning
How to do Lesson Planning
How to complete a Scheme of Work
Evaluation, Feedback and Review
Policies, procedures and codes
Record Keeping
How to deliver inclusive and motivating learning
You are allocated a mentor who will be available to answer any questions. She/he will contact you within 48 hours of registering to introduce him/herself. You may contact your mentor at anytime to ask questions and get advice throughout the course. Your mentor will also be the person to mark your assignments and orchestrate your micro teach.
Once you have completed the Moodle and completed all your assignments, you will complete the micro teach. Your mentor will then help you put your portfolio together which is submitted for internal and external verification.
What is the micro teach?
This is held in locations across the UK on a monthly basis. Your mentor will arrange your micro teach. This involves presenting a 15 minute teaching session to your peers and mentor. Your peers will evaluate your micro teach and your mentor will carry out an assessment. You will then evaluate 3 of your peers teaching sessions.
